Dr. Dale Rader, M.D. is a fellowship trained orthopedic surgeon specializing in the treatment of sports injuries, as well as joint replacements. Dr. Rader pursued his undergraduate degree at Wabash College, where he also played basketball. Dr. Rader graduated with honors from the Howard University College of Medicine. He continued his medical training at the University of Miami orthopedic surgery residency program. Dr. Rader’s love of sports led him to further specialize his training by doing a sports medicine fellowship at the University of Cincinnati, where he worked with the Cincinnati Bengals of the NFL.
Originally from Chicago, Dr. Rader realized he wanted to work in a warmer climate after living in Miami for his orthopedic residency, and North Carolina definitely fit the bill. Dr. Rader is married to his lovely wife, Dr. Rachel Rader. They have three children, Carrie, Dane, and Rhea. In his free time, he enjoys spending time with his family, playing golf, traveling, and listening to music. Dr. Rader is an active member of his church where he serves as an usher. He delights in seeing his patients become pain-free and improving their quality of life. He has thoroughly enjoyed serving the Statesville and Foothills community.
